Art Deco District
If you’re visiting South Beach make a stop at the Art Deco District Right along Ocean Drive. This historic neighborhood is known for all of its color and architecture, taking you back to the 90’s. Snap some pics across the Colony or Avalon Hotel.
Take your pick from high-end retail stores such as Hermes, or Louis Vuitton to posing next to larger-than-life Art Sculptures, you’ll have dozens of options when taking pictures here.
South Pointe Park
If you’re looking to take sunset pictures in Miami Beach stop by South Pointe Park. From Palm trees, to ocean views, this is one of the best locations to see the sunset overlooking the Miami skyline.

You might have heard of the Seven Magic Mountains in Las Vegas, well over in Miami, you can find the 8th Magic Mountain located in Collins Park, outside of the Bass Museum.
Welcome to Miami Beach Sign
The infamous welcome sign is located on the Julia Tuttle Causeway. You won’t be able to take a selfie with this sign as it’s located on a highway. Once you see it, prepare the passenger or anyone in the car to have the camera ready for a quick snap.
